Kamala on Biden presidency pot policy: 'No time for incrementalism, no time for half-stepping'

The Recount @therecount
Sen. Kamala Harris (D-CA) says a Biden-Harris administration would decriminalize marijuana and expunge marijuana use convictions: “This is no time for incrementalism ... there needs to be significant change in the design of the system.”
